Issue Possible Cause & Solution Reference
I cannot call entries in the
phonebook.
•You are trying to make a TEL line call, but the unit is not set to
make TEL calls.
→Make sure the "Line Selection" setting is set to "IP +
TEL".
page 23
•You are trying to make an IP line call, but the "Operation
Mode" setting is not correct.
→Change the setting to "Peer to Peer" if you want to make
or receive peer to peer IP calls (i.e., calls made by
specifying the called party's IP address).
→Change the setting to "IP-PBX" if you want to make or
receive intercom and outside calls as a SIP extension of the
connected PBX.
page 25
The unit returns to standby
mode while adding or
editing phonebook entries.
•1 minute has passed since you pressed a button.
→If you pause for over 1 minute while adding or editing
phonebook entries, the unit returns to standby mode.

ProgrammingIssue Possible Cause & Solution Reference
The unit returns to standby
mode while programming
the unit.
•1 minute has passed since you pressed a button.
→If you pause for over 1 minute while programming the unit,
the unit returns to standby mode.
—
I cannot program the unit. •You are on a call.
→Program the unit once you have finished the call. —
•A call is being received.
→The unit exits programming mode automatically when a call
is received. Program the unit again once you have finished
the call.
—
After I changed the settings,
the changes do not take
effect.
•The unit must be restarted before the new setting becomes
effective.
→Restart the unit.
